From Executive Producer Dick Wolf, this true crime investigative series follows veteran prosecutor Kelly Siegler, and her rotating team of seasoned detectives, as they travel to small towns across the country and help local law-enforcement agencies dig into unsolved homicide cases that have lingered for years without answers or justice for the victims due to lack of funding and proper forensic technology.

Trivia, insights & behind the scenes
Siegler was a real Harris County prosecutor with a 68-0 trial record before the show — she's not playing a role, she's doing her job with cameras.
The show's entire premise exposes how thousands of US homicide cases stall simply because rural departments can't afford basic DNA testing — entertainment as accidental journalism.
